At the sublimation temperature, for the process `CO_(2)(S)toCO_(2)(g)`

A

`DeltaH , DeltaS` and`DeltaG` are all positive

B

`DeltaH gt 0,DeltaS gt 0` and `DeltaG lt 0`

C

`DeltaH lt 0 , DeltaS gt 0` and `DeltaG lt 0`

D

`DeltaH gt0, DeltaS gt 0` and`DeltaG = 0`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
D

As the process is in equilibrium,`DeltaG =0`. But `DeltaG=0`only when the two factors `DeltaH`and `T DeltaS` oppose each other and equal in magnitude `( DeltaG =DeltaH - T DeltaS)`. Thus, we should have either `DeltaH` and `DeltaS`both `+ve` or both -ve, i.e., `DeltaH gt 0` and`DeltaS gt 0` or `DeltaH lt 0` and `DeltaS lt0`
